
Longmont Children’s Council announced today that it will host a tea-time community open house, April 23, 2009, to honor Mayor Roger Lange and his commitment to early childhood education. In addition to being presented with the Plumtastic Award for Excellence in Supporting Early Childhood Education, Mayor Lange will read the next installment of the Mayor’s Book Club reading series. Classroom tours, student artwork, and curriculum demonstrations will also be featured.

About Longmont Children’s Council:
Longmont Children’s Council (LCC) prepares children for a lifetime of learning and self-sufficiency by providing a comprehensive, individualized approach to early childhood education and family wellness. For over 40 years, LCC has been providing comprehensive preschool programming to low-income 3- and 4- year-olds living in Longmont. LCC clients receive educational pre-school classes, health and dental screenings, mental health services, nutrition information, parent education, family support/case management, and transportation services. All services are offered bi-lingually and provided free of charge. LCC is now serving 198 children from 181 families.
